E-Mail Size Limits?
Technoman asks: "I work for a company that for the past four years has restricted individual e-mail messages to 5 meg each. We now have users suggesting that this limit is to small and hinders them in performing their job. I would like to know how others are using size limits, and if not how they deal with large e-mails." As human communication over the net becomes more and more complex, the "acceptable size" of an email message will increase. 10 years ago, if you got an email over 10k, something was seriously amiss; but these days, that is just a flash in the pan. Many people rely on email, not FTP to transfer files, and things like a few family portraits can easily exceed several megs in size, so drawing the line for all users may not be as easy as you think, depending on your users and your network. Put simply, if you were the administrator of an e-mail server, what would you set the maximum size of an incoming email message to be, and what would be the reasoning behind said limit?
I have to agree with previous posts. Email is not a file transfer protocol, it's a mail protocol. It's designed for text. If you want to send files, use a protocol that was designed for it like FTP, HTTP, or DCC file transfer.
If your company is smart they use an instant messenger. If not, I suggest you use one. Using an instant messenger users can send files between each other without going through servers.
Don't duplicate work, check out the horde project. They have an excellent file manager for web use, coded in php.
Read my plan to save the Bengals
It's nice for all of us as geeks to say "make the users use FTP" (though frankly, I'd prefer scp or nothing), but it isn't practical.
I work in a not-for-profit that publishes a weekly journal, so we are both "an academic environment" (we operate somewhat like a unversity), and a good-size for-profit company. To that end, the requirements of our user community are very different.
We used to traffic a lot of paper and film via FedEx and couriers, and moving all that processing to electronic mediums saves us over $300k/year. I should know, I had a big hand in implementing our digital workflow (why do you think they bought me an Aibo?). Our technology spending isn't any more than it was when everything was paper based, but our saving have been huge.
We use Groupwise for corporate email, and the post offices live on a SAN virtual disk. Our SAN has over 2TB in storage, Netware lets you concat volume segments dynamically, and Groupwise only stores a message once in the database and passes pointers to each internal recipient. So storing large attachments is very efficient, and enlarging the post offices is trivial. Our SAN is only 33% populated, and smaller drives (75GB) can be replaced on the fly with larger drives (180GB) and the array will resize and rebuild itself hot.
So we have no inbound or outbound attachment limit, though we do keep an eye on things to make sure people don't go nuts. We just upgraded our servers last weekend after 2 1/2 years in service, despite our post offices growing by a factor of 10. Having administered Exchange, Notes, and Groupwise, I think we've got the best of the three groupware packages, and our users are happy enough (they would be happy, but who is every happy at the phone company because they have a dial tone?)
In three years, we did turn up our bandwidth from (2) T-1s to a 6mbt fractional DS-3, but email only accounts for a small portion of that traffic (we host half a dozen more websites than we used to).
The largest attachment I ever emailed was probably 100MB, and I honestly find 5MB limits to be draconian. We have an FTP drop, but our vendors won't use it. Last month, I had to email a vendor a dat tape with 13MB of data because they have a 5MB attachment limit. Sick.
"All I ever wanted was to see Larry Wall give Bill Gates a Perl necklace."
http://www.eisenschmidt.org/jweisen
It's genenerally not a 5M limit on mail BOXES, but individual messages.
With modern mail stores, mail box limits of 100M / user is fairly realistic, although you can KILL your mail server if you use POP with frequent checks and "leave mail on the server" options.
5M is a resonable max to expect someone to get over a modem, although that's pretty bad too.
In most sane email servers, a 10MB attachment sent to 200 people would take up ... 10MB plus pointers. What are you using?
I like music